Who is Rabum Alal?
The Black Swans were the disciples of Doctor Doom, who had formed a religion around his identity as Rabum Alal. The Swans were used as his pawns to fulfill his mission of destruction of every Molecule Men across the Multiverse to oppose the plans of the Beyonders.

Who is black priest Doctor Strange?
The Black Priests are powerful beings who are major players in the Game of Worlds, destroying intrusive Earths to save both of the universes involved in an Incursion, with the hopes that destroying enough Earths could stabilize the Multiverse.

How strong is Corvus Glaive?
Powers. Superhuman Strength: Corvus Glaive had considerable levels of superhuman strength. His physical strength allowed him to pin down the weakened Vision as well as overpower Captain America in hand-to-hand combat.
Who created Black Swan in New Avengers?
Creation. Black Swan was created by New Avengers writer Jonathan Hickman and artist Steve Epting. She first appeared in the third volume of New Avengers #1 released in 2013.
